Output e2e7323ef0061629ce86b1c8e75433740a7dd56408fa044c4136c0561ddff598:2

value
27235017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44e6eb17ffad3eb9df5702309604c3a4781753a8 OP_EQUAL
address
MEBUoxjuZPg3qxc1SG5kfsAdd3CvtiUgpm
transaction
e2e7323ef0061629ce86b1c8e75433740a7dd56408fa044c4136c0561ddff598
spent
true